NEWBURGH — The office staff of the town of Newburgh has resigned en-masse.

At what was supposed to be a routine meeting Thursday of the Board of Selectmen, Town Manager Rick Briggs, Town Clerk Lois Libby and Assistant Town Clerk Jill Gilman handed in their resignations.

Part-time Treasurer Sue Lessard did not resign, but because she was an appointee of Briggs she is technically no longer a town employee.

The resignations follow a complete turnover of the board.

The Bangor Daily News says the three employees who stepped down Thursday cited a caustic atmosphere created by a group of concerned citizens who have been combing through town records and challenging officials on a range of issues.
